While foundational segmentation provides a good starting point for personalized email marketing, truly effective micro-targeting demands an intricate understanding of individual customer behaviors and preferences. This deep dive explores the specific, actionable techniques to collect, verify, and analyze data that fuels sophisticated micro-targeted personalization, transforming raw data into precise, personalized messaging that boosts engagement and conversions.
1. Implementing Advanced Tracking Mechanisms for Granular Data Collection
The backbone of micro-targeted personalization is rich, real-time data. To gather this, marketers must deploy a combination of tracking technologies that capture nuanced customer interactions:
- Cookies: Use first-party cookies to monitor page visits, session duration, and user preferences. Configure cookies with a lifespan aligned to your campaign goals, ensuring persistent data collection without violating privacy norms.
- Pixel Tags: Embed pixel tags (tracking pixels) within your email templates and landing pages. These small, invisible images trigger data collection upon email open or webpage visit, allowing behavior tracking without intrusive prompts.
- Event Tracking: Leverage JavaScript-based event listeners to monitor specific actions—such as button clicks, form submissions, or video plays. Integrate with your analytics platform (e.g., Google Analytics, Mixpanel) to log these events with detailed metadata.
“Use a combination of pixel tracking and event tracking to build a comprehensive picture of individual user journeys. This multi-layered approach ensures no critical interaction goes unnoticed.”
2. Ensuring Data Integrity: Handling Missing, Inconsistent, and Incomplete Data
Data quality issues are the Achilles’ heel of effective personalization. Implement systematic processes to ensure data accuracy and completeness:
- Data Validation: Use validation rules at data entry points—such as required fields and format checks—to prevent erroneous inputs.
- Automated Cleaning Scripts: Schedule ETL (Extract, Transform, Load) processes that detect and correct anomalies, such as duplicate entries or inconsistent formats.
- Handling Missing Data: Apply imputation techniques like mean, median, or mode substitution for numerical data, and use predictive models to infer missing categorical data.
“Prioritize data validation at collection points but complement it with automated cleaning scripts. This hybrid approach minimizes errors that could lead to misguided personalization.”
3. Applying Machine Learning to Predict Preferences and Behaviors
Once high-quality data is in place, advanced analytics can extract predictive insights:
| ML Model Type | Use Case | Implementation Tips |
|---|---|---|
| Logistic Regression | Predict likelihood of purchase within a specific timeframe | Use for binary classification; normalize features for better accuracy |
| Random Forest | Identify key predictors of churn or engagement | Handle large feature sets; validate with cross-validation |
| Neural Networks | Personalize product recommendations based on complex browsing patterns | Requires substantial data; tune hyperparameters carefully |
For example, a retailer can train a random forest model to predict which customers are likely to respond to a specific promotion, thereby enabling targeted offers that maximize ROI.
4. Building a Real-Time Data Pipeline for Dynamic Personalization
Creating a seamless flow from data collection to personalization requires a robust, scalable data pipeline:
- Data Ingestion: Use tools like Apache Kafka or AWS Kinesis for real-time data streaming from tracking points.
- Data Storage: Store raw data in scalable warehouses like Amazon Redshift or Google BigQuery, ensuring fast retrieval.
- Data Processing: Implement Spark or Flink to process streaming data, apply transformations, and generate features on the fly.
- Model Serving: Deploy trained models via REST APIs to your email platform or personalization engine, enabling real-time scoring.
“The key to effective micro-targeting is not just data collection but also the speed at which insights are generated and acted upon. A well-designed real-time pipeline bridges this gap.”
5. Practical Tips and Common Pitfalls in Data Analysis for Personalization
Implementing these data strategies is complex—here are concrete tips to ensure success:
- Tip: Regularly audit your data pipeline for latency, completeness, and accuracy. Use dashboards that flag anomalies in real-time.
- Pitfall: Relying solely on historical data without considering recent behavioral shifts can lead to outdated personalization. Incorporate streaming data for fresh insights.
- Tip: Use feature engineering techniques—such as creating composite features like “average purchase value over last 3 interactions”—to enhance model predictions.
- Pitfall: Overfitting your models to training data results in poor generalization. Apply cross-validation and avoid overly complex models for small datasets.
6. Case Study: Data-Driven Personalization in Action
An online fashion retailer integrated real-time event tracking with machine learning models to personalize email content dynamically. They used browsing history, time spent on categories, and past purchase data to feed a gradient boosting model predicting next-best products. Implementing a real-time data pipeline allowed instant updates of product recommendations in emails, leading to a 25% increase in click-through rates and a 15% boost in conversions within three months.
7. Connecting Data Analysis to Broader Marketing Strategies
To maximize the impact of micro-targeted personalization, integrate your data insights into broader marketing automation workflows. Use platforms like HubSpot or Marketo to trigger personalized emails based on real-time behavioral signals. Continuously refine your models and data pipelines based on performance metrics such as open rates, CTR, and ROI. For a comprehensive understanding of how these technical foundations fit into wider marketing strategies, explore {tier1_anchor}.